This page presents Zoomify Converter
upgrade alternatives - input, processing, and output options
- that are useful to imaging enthusiasts, web professionals,
and vertical market experts with special needs. The Zoomify Converter intelligently converts any image for incremental on-demand access. It creates a collection of image pieces at many levels of resolution - a "pyramid of tiles". The Zoomify Image Viewer is then able to download the specific tiles that are needed for the current view - the part of the image that fits in the display at the disired degree of zoom. As included in our products, the Zoomify Converter supports input source images in TIF, PNG, BMP, and JPEG formats. Images must use the RBG color model rather than CMYK. The Converter is a dual-threaded, 32-bit application, available for Macintosh and Windows platforms. It has no size limit for input source image files and requires no key or other registration process. In addition, the Converter is able to convert between Zoomify formats - from Zoomify Folder storage to ZIF, and vice versa. No tile decoding/encoding is required, so quality is not impacted and the process is very fast. Specifications |
Conversion is optimized to run entirely in memory whenever possible! When running entirely in memory, conversion speeds can be expected to be up to twice as fast for JPEG source images and up to three times as fast for TIF source images. For files many gigabytes in size (uncompressed), where sufficient memory is not available, the Converter will write to disk as required. Supported input formats include: TIF, PNG, BMP, JPEG, as well as BigTIFF, tiled TIF and multi-file input via text list input (ACI text format). If support for other input formats is required please contact us. Supported output formats include: Zoomify Image Folder and Zoomify Image File (ZIF). Zoomify output formats also supported as inputs to enable optimized conversion of content libraries. Note: activation key input required on first use.

The following conversion scripts were created by Zoomify customers or partners and have been used by many customers with success. They are useful in contexts requiring custom functionality, deep integration with server-side scripts, or on Linux/Unix. Options include use various scripting language/image library combinations: PERL/ImageMagick, PHP/GD-Library, and Python/PIL/Zope. In some cases wrappers are providing in one language for conversion in another. Users of other scripting languages and image libraries will find these examples useful as well because they represent codebase starting points that can be ported. In addtion, notes are provided regarding incremental source image access (see the last item below). Limitations: The script-based conversion solutions included are capable of generating Zoomify Images in folder-based form. They do not currently support creation of Zoomify images in the ZIF or PFF single-file formats. Additionally, as scripted solutions these Converter alternatives are not expected to perform as quickly as a compiled application. Some will also likely require greater memory resources as they do not incrementally load source image data, but rather, load the entire source image into memory (these are therefore appropriate, if not further enhanced, only for images tens or hundreds of megabytes in size, not gigabytes in size. Please also note: these scripted conversion options were created by customers or partners of Zoomify and Zoomify has not reviewed or tested them. Delivery, Activation Keys, And Custom Needs |
|||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||
PRODUCT DELIVERY NOTE: Upon purchase of any of these special Converter
Upgrade products, you will will receive a confirmation email. You
will then receive a second email message with your application download
link and activation key - within 72 hours. MOVING A CONVERTER TO A NEW MACHINE: Moving a Converter from one
machine to another requires first unregistering the activation key.
Turbo and non-Turbo Converters use completely separate activation
key systems. For Turbo Converters, unregister a key using the -u parameter.
For non-Turbo Converters please contact Support and the key will be
manually unregistered on the key server. In both cases, re-registering
the Converter on the new machine then requires reusing the -r parameter
as described above. |
